We studied the effects of amendment with zeolitized tuffs (ZT) in recovering nitrogen and phosphorus as potential plant nutrients in soils treated with wastewater (WW). The surface horizon of two contrasting soils (a sandy, alkaline Entisol, and a sandy-loam, sub-acidic Alfisol), was pedotechnically managed with different ratios of Neapolitan Yellow Tuff (NYT) and a clinoptilolite bearing tuff (ZCL).
